AXA Assistance USA offers three comprehensive policies on Squaremouth, all underwritten by Nationwide Mutual Insurance Company. Their Platinum plan is the most popular and offers up to $250,000 in medical coverage along with the best baggage protection available on the marketplace.

AXA customers frequently mention the provider’s efficient customer service, especially when it comes to making pre-departure adjustments to a policy. However, some customers have voiced that the claims process takes too long and lacks transparency.

Policy was misrepresented when sold to me. Example, trip interruption (150% of trip cost which would have been $9600 and was listed on policy as such) but in details, limited to $100/d with max of $3200 and the $3200 max was not listed on policy)
